发明名称 System and method for debugging system-on-chips using single or n-cycle stepping
摘要 Large, complex SoCs comprise interconnections of various functional blocks, which blocks frequently running on different clock domains. By effectively controlling the clocks within the SoC, this invention provides a means to halt execution of a SoC and to then single or n-cycle step its execution in a real system environment. Accordingly, the invention provides an effective debugging tool to both the SoC designer and software designers whose code is executed by the SoC as it provides them the capability of studying the cause and effect of interactions between functional blocks. The invention is also applicable to SoCs containing only one functional block while containing complex circuitry operating on a clock different than the block's clock. In particular, the invention permits halting of the block clock and then single or n-cycle stepping its execution to permit analysis of the interactions between the block and the SoC circuitry.
申请公布号 US7055117(B2) 申请公布日期 2006.05.30
申请号 US20030748068 申请日期 2003.12.29
申请人 AGERE SYSTEMS, INC. 发明人 YEE OCEAGER P.
分类号 G06F11/28;G06F17/50;G01R31/317;G06F11/22;G06F11/36 主分类号 G06F11/28
代理机构 代理人
主权项
地址